In 2001, I thought I was going to die, soon. I had, by a fluke, survived a massive heart attack, in June of that year,....but at the time, statistics for survival, after a heart attack, were predictable,...6 months to a year. So each memory of my life up to that point in time,...I was only 47,....I tried to memorize and contemplate. I began thinking of all the wonderful things I would miss, if I died soon. I thought about things I would take or miss if I died. To my surprise, I survived and flourished,....as I am now 65. I made sure to ride my motorcycle every possible day, the weather was good. I partied with all my friends more,... & spent more time with my girlfriend. I got another kitten, quit my job,.....worked outdoors, in my garden, & contributed to helping out others in my community. This song is very meaningful to me.

Sorry for these questions but I wonder how the native speaker understands the meaning of 'I have worn the faces off all the cards...' - I cannot clearly understand what is the first assiciation that the English speaker would have here... for me it is like photographs but as I am not native I amd not sure it is correct... I never heard cards used as photos in English.. but otherewise I cannot get what it referes to. What it the poetic allusion or image that can be graspped by native speaker here. Also.. Beaula is just someone's name I believe... some realistic detail so typical for his lyrics? Thank you
Yury - the line about faces on cards is obscure even to a native speaker. All part of the magic. I've taken it to mean something like played the game (as in cards) of life so hard, he's worn out the cards. And yes, Beaula is a name, a rather old fashioned southern name.
